US told to toe line on climate
Britain and Germany yesterday joined forces to warn President George Bush that talks on climate change must take place within a United Nations framework and not in an ad hoc process floated last week by Bush.

As violent protesters clashed with police in Rostock ahead of next week's G8 summit in Germany, Washington was warned that Britain and Europe will not tolerate a separate process.

'For me, that is non-negotiable,' the German Chancellor Angela Merkel said of the need to ensure that climate change negotiations take place within the existing UN framework.

Her remarks were echoed by Hilary Benn, Britain's international development secretary. 'I think it is very important that we stick with the framework we've got,' Benn told The Observer
